Snapdragon Fireworks

2nd-level evocation

Casting Time: 1 action

Range: 500 feet

Components: V, S

Duration: Concentration, up to 1 minute

Classes: bard, sorcerer, wizard

You create fireworks in the shapes of tiny dragons, flowers, or almost anything you like. Each round as a bonus action, you may launch a firework on a zigzag path to strike a 5-foot-square, erupting with a bright flash and a loud bang and dealing 1d4 fire damage and 1d4 thunder damage, or half as much on a successful Dexterity saving throw.

Creatures failing their saving throw against a firework are dazzled by their brightness, taking a -1 penalty on attack rolls, AC, and Wisdom (Perception) checks for 1 round.

Each round you continue concentrating, you may launch another firework, and you can change their coloration or appearance each time.

This spell is very popular at pastoral halfling celebrations and feasts, especially around midsummer. Normally when this spell is used as part of a festival, the chosen target is high in the sky to increase visibility and protect observers.
